Elossapitojärjestelmän, often translated as "ecosystem services," refers to the benefits that humans derive from the natural environment and from the sustainable management of ecosystems. These services are crucial for human well-being and are broadly categorized into four main types: provisioning, regulating, cultural, and supporting services.
